Dan Orlovsky was born in August 1983 in Bridgeport, Connecticut. He attended Shelton High School and was a quarterback. Orlovsky attended Connecticut University for his college football career. The Detroit Lions selected him #145 overall in the 2005 NFL Draft. From 2005 to 2008, Dan Orlovsky was a member of the Lions. From 2009 to 2010, he was a member of the Houston Texans, and in 2011, he was a member of the Indianapolis Colts. From 2012 to 2013, Orlovsky was a member of the Tampa Bay Buccaneers. From 2014 to 2016, he was a member of the Lions once more. He had 298 completions for 3,132 yards, 15 touchdowns, and 13 interceptions in his career. Orlovsky was signed by the Tampa Bay Buccaneers on March 15, 2012. The Buccaneers cut Orlovsky on April 4th of the following year, but he was re-signed with them on April 4th of the following year. He joined with the Detroit Lions as a backup quarterback to Matthew Stafford on April 2, 2014. Dan signed with the Los Angeles Rams on July 20, 2017. He was discharged by the team on September 2nd, 2017. Dan announced his retirement on October 11th, 2017. Keep an eye on Playerswiki.

He signed a two-year, $2.5 million contract with Tampa Bay on March 15, 2012. He signed a one-year, $905k contract with Tampa Bay on April 8, 2013. He signed a one-year, $920,000 contract with Detroit on April 2, 2014. On March 2, 2015, his contract with Detroit was extended to a one-year $1.05 million deal, and on March 11, 2016, it was extended to a one-year $1.065 million deal. On July 20th, 2017, Dan signed a one-year, $1.08 million contract with Los Angeles.

The Detroit Lions selected Orlovsky 145th overall in the fifth round of the 2005 NFL Draft. When Jeff Garcia was injured in the 2005 preseason, Orlovsky became the Lions' primary backup quarterback. In 2005, he appeared in two regular-season games, including a nationally televised game against the Atlanta Falcons on Thanksgiving Day. Orlovsky completed 7-of-17 passes for 63 yards in the two games combined, with no touchdowns or interceptions. The Lions traded Joey Harrington and released Jeff Garcia prior to the 2006 season, while adding Jon Kitna and Josh McCown. Orlovsky was the third-string quarterback for the 2006 season. Because Drew Stanton, who was selected in the second round of the 2007 NFL Draft, was placed on injured reserve, Orlovsky was predicted to be the second-string quarterback in 2007. However, the Lions added J. T. O'Sullivan, who pushed Orlovsky back to third on the depth chart. In 2006 and 2007, Orlovsky did not play a single regular-season snap; in 2008, O'Sullivan joined the San Francisco 49ers as their starting quarterback.
